#1 SSL Usage

First things first, make sure your website is SSL certified. To those who are still new to this field, an SSL, or Secure Sockets Layer, certificate permits an encrypted connection and verifies the legitimacy of a website. It is a security protocol that establishes a secure connection between a web browser and a web server.

Simply put, SSL protects internet connections by preventing hackers from reading or altering data sent between two computers. When the URL in the address bar has a padlock icon next to it, that’s how you know if a website uses an SSL certificate to secure that particular website.


#2 Strengthen Your Login Credentials

Using strong letters for your login details is essential to keeping your account secure. There are a few other ways to tighten your login credentials, including:

  • Use difficult passwords

As crucial as it is to ensure your password is confidential, you might want to harden it with a long one that has multiple characters and a mix of letters, numbers, and symbols so no one can ever guess it. Make sure you use different passwords for different apps and websites so that hackers cannot guess them. 

  • Take advantage of 2-factor authentication

When 2-factor authentication is activated, a second step must be completed before anyone may access your data. 2FA strengthens your login security by adding an additional layer of authentication, typically a fleeting, dynamically generated code sent to your phone number or email.


#3 Observe Your Website

To maintain a good performance, you need to monitor your website regularly. The first step is to always scan for malware. Malware can infect a website in a variety of ways, including through stolen login information, false or harmful plugins and themes, corrupted software, and more. Malware has the potential to seriously harm your website and online business. The best defence against it is a safe web hosting environment and ongoing supervision.


#4 Do Regular Back Up

Thatch your roof before the rain begins. Backing up your site constantly and keeping an eye on the updates can protect your website from unusual incidents like losing internal data or, even worse, getting infected by viruses.

  • DDOS Protection

A Denial of Service (DDOS) protection limits the impact of the attack by preventing malicious traffic from reaching its target while allowing regular traffic to pass to conduct business as usual. Hackers often use this method to harm your websites, so this is very important for you to keep in mind.

  • Web Application Firewall on the server

The web application firewall keeps track of traffic and prevents hackers from taking advantage of numerous typical application security flaws. Although there are various ways to handle this demand, such as WordPress plugins or third-party services, a server-level WAF is crucial since it deals with massive data in real time.

  • PHP maintenance

For your website to remain secure, PHP must be kept up to date. Many web hosting providers frequently ignore this in order to make PHP maintenance easier, even though older PHP versions are frequently a gateway for security flaws and malware.
